Scope of the Position
The Warehouse/ Delivery Driver will be responsible for picking, packing, wrapping, and labeling products in an efficient manner. This position is responsible for the loading and unloading of regular shipments, which includes heavy lifting up to and including 50 lbs., and the use of any material handling equipment. Also responsible for delivering products to customers daily. They are responsible for driving to and from between the pickup place and the destination, delivering goods/products and collecting the payment.
Major Responsibilities
- Works independently to manually pick orders accurately and in a timely manner
- Accurately counts and put inventory back into stock
- Counting, packing, wrapping and labeling products onto skids.
- Loading and unloading trucks
- Assist in wire cutting and customer counter when needed
- Makes sure that incoming and outgoing products and material are in good condition
- Reliably works as a team to ensure warehouse cleanliness
- Responsible for carrying out any other duties assigned by management

Skills and Qualifications
- Minimum two year of Warehouse experience
- Basic math skills and math reasoning
- Must be willing to be Forklift trained
- Valid G License with a clean divers abstract
- Experience driving a 3 ton/5ton truck/Flatbed
- Responsible and reliable
- Ability to multitask and prioritize
- Excellent time management, organizational and money handling skills
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al
- Good health and physical strength
- Accuracy in following instructions
- Customer-service orientation with a Professional demeanor
